Title:Ubuntu: Security Advisory (USN-4814-1)
Summary:The remote host is missing an update for the 'asterisk' package(s) announced via the USN-4814-1 advisory.
Description:Summary:
The remote host is missing an update for the 'asterisk' package(s) announced via the USN-4814-1 advisory.

Vulnerability Insight:
Richard Mudgett discovered that Asterisk did not properly check the length
of input string when setting the user field for PartyB on a CDR. A remote
attacker could use this vulnerability to cause a denial of service (crash)
or potentially execute arbitrary code. (CVE-2017-16671)

Alex Villacis Lasso discovered that Asterisk did not properly check the
length of input string when setting the user field for PartyA on a CDR. A
remote attacker could use this vulnerability to cause a denial of service
(crash) or potentially execute arbitrary code. (CVE-2017-7617)

Affected Software/OS:
'asterisk' package(s) on Ubuntu 16.04.

Solution:
Please install the updated package(s).

CVSS Score:
6.5

CVSS Vector:
AV:N/AC:L/Au:S/C:P/I:P/A:P
